advocate (verb)
to publicly support or recommend. Can be used as a noun/person.
allude
to refer indirectly.
allusion
reference to something commonly known.
ambivalent
having mixed or conflicting feelings.
analogy
a comparison to clarify or explain.
assertion
a strong declaration or claim.
colloquial
informal or conversational language.
concise
expressed clearly in few words.
delineation
a detailed description or representation.
digress
to stray from the main subject.
exemplify
to illustrate by example.
implication
a conclusion that can be drawn indirectly.
juxtapose
to place side by side for contrast.
logos
an appeal to logic or reason.
nuance
a subtle distinction or difference.
paradox
a statement that contradicts itself but reveals truth.
pathos
an appeal to emotion.
qualify (argument)
to limit or modify a claim. Some, most, many, few.
ethos
an appeal to credibility or character.
synthesize
to combine parts into a whole.
validate
to confirm or prove the truth of something.
